Output e89508eb46199bc3edd014fdc4e1886fc49e8f093fe10ec702c5381fcee55c4b:1

value
5658524
script pubkey
OP_0 OP_PUSHBYTES_20 5f084a7a46c689a83023d846b31c680f05fd381b
address
bc1qtuyy57jxc6y6svprmprtx8rgpuzl6wqmhpja4x
transaction
e89508eb46199bc3edd014fdc4e1886fc49e8f093fe10ec702c5381fcee55c4b
spent
true